Skip to content


Subversion checkout URL

You can clone with
Download ZIP
Tree: 1a3f0c9326
Fetching contributors…

Cannot retrieve contributors at this time

15 lines (8 sloc) 0.4 kB
INVARIANT: Keep track of the time remaining until the next packet in the pipe should be
released to the reader side
Block until either timeout is reached, or a new packet has entered the pipe
If new packet arrived, place all queued packets in chronological order, ascending in
delivery time
If timeout reached, deliver packet to user read (unblock the read call)
Repeat forever
Jump to Line
Something went wrong with that request. Please try again.